HomeSort by relevance Sort by last modified time
    Searched refs:vattr (Results 1 - 25 of 140) sorted by null

1 2 3 4 5 6

  /netvirt/usr/src/uts/common/syscall/
utime.c 125 get_utimesvattr(struct timeval *tvptr, struct vattr *vattr, int *flags)
149 vattr->va_atime.tv_sec = tv[0].tv_sec;
150 vattr->va_atime.tv_nsec = tv[0].tv_usec * 1000;
151 vattr->va_mtime.tv_sec = tv[1].tv_sec;
152 vattr->va_mtime.tv_nsec = tv[1].tv_usec * 1000;
155 gethrestime(&vattr->va_atime);
156 vattr->va_mtime = vattr->va_atime;
158 vattr->va_mask = AT_ATIME | AT_MTIME
165 struct vattr vattr; local
181 struct vattr vattr; local
219 struct vattr vattr; local
    [all...]
chmod.c 63 struct vattr vattr; local
65 vattr.va_mode = fmode & MODEMASK;
66 vattr.va_mask = AT_MODE;
67 return (namesetattr(fname, FOLLOW, &vattr, 0));
76 struct vattr vattr; local
78 vattr.va_mode = fmode & MODEMASK;
79 vattr.va_mask = AT_MODE;
80 return (fdsetattr(fd, &vattr));
    [all...]
mkdir.c 56 struct vattr vattr; local
59 vattr.va_type = VDIR;
60 vattr.va_mode = dmode & PERMMASK;
61 vattr.va_mask = AT_TYPE|AT_MODE;
62 error = vn_create(dname, UIO_USERSPACE, &vattr, EXCL, 0, &vp, CRMKDIR,
stat.c 249 vattr_t vattr; local
252 vattr.va_mask = AT_STAT | AT_NBLOCKS | AT_BLKSIZE | AT_SIZE;
253 if ((error = VOP_GETATTR(vp, &vattr, flag, cr, NULL)) != 0)
272 if ((vattr.va_size > MAXOFF32_T) &&
275 vattr.va_size = MAXOFF32_T;
278 if (vattr.va_size > MAXOFF_T || vattr.va_nblocks > LONG_MAX ||
279 vattr.va_nodeid > ULONG_MAX)
283 sb.st_dev = vattr.va_fsid;
284 sb.st_ino = (ino_t)vattr.va_nodeid
396 vattr_t vattr; local
517 vattr_t vattr; local
622 vattr_t vattr; local
    [all...]
mknod.c 61 struct vattr vattr; local
79 vattr.va_type = IFTOVT(fmode);
80 vattr.va_mode = fmode & MODEMASK;
81 vattr.va_mask = AT_TYPE|AT_MODE;
82 if (vattr.va_type == VCHR || vattr.va_type == VBLK) {
87 vattr.va_rdev = dev;
88 vattr.va_mask |= AT_RDEV;
91 if (error = vn_create(fname, UIO_USERSPACE, &vattr, EXCL, 0, &vp
    [all...]
lseek.c 81 struct vattr vattr; local
114 vattr.va_mask = AT_SIZE;
115 if (error = VOP_GETATTR(vp, &vattr, 0, fp->f_cred, NULL)) {
118 if (reg && (off > (max - (offset_t)vattr.va_size))) {
122 noff = (u_offset_t)(off + (offset_t)vattr.va_size);
144 vattr.va_mask = AT_SIZE;
145 error = VOP_GETATTR(vp, &vattr, 0, fp->f_cred, NULL);
148 if (noff >= (u_offset_t)vattr.va_size)
173 vattr.va_mask = AT_SIZE
278 struct vattr vattr; local
    [all...]
symlink.c 59 struct vattr vattr; local
82 vattr.va_type = VLNK;
83 vattr.va_mode = 0777;
84 vattr.va_mask = AT_TYPE|AT_MODE;
85 error = VOP_SYMLINK(dvp, lpn.pn_path, &vattr,
chown.c 69 struct vattr vattr; local
78 vattr.va_uid = uid;
79 vattr.va_gid = gid;
80 vattr.va_mask = 0;
81 if (vattr.va_uid != -1)
82 vattr.va_mask |= AT_UID;
83 if (vattr.va_gid != -1)
84 vattr.va_mask |= AT_GID;
139 error = VOP_SETATTR(vp, &vattr, 0, CRED(), NULL)
    [all...]
readlink.c 60 struct vattr vattr; local
79 vattr.va_mask = AT_TYPE;
80 error = VOP_GETATTR(vp, &vattr, 0, CRED(), NULL);
81 if (error || vattr.va_type != VLNK) {
ioctl.c 66 struct vattr vattr; local
91 vattr.va_mask = AT_SIZE;
92 error = VOP_GETATTR(vp, &vattr, 0, fp->f_cred, NULL);
97 offset = MIN(vattr.va_size - fp->f_offset, INT_MAX);
fcntl.c 79 struct vattr vattr; local
530 vattr.va_mask = AT_SIZE;
531 if ((error = VOP_GETATTR(vp, &vattr, 0, CRED(), NULL))
534 begin = start > vattr.va_size ? vattr.va_size : start;
535 length = vattr.va_size > start ? vattr.va_size - start :
536 start - vattr.va_size;
694 struct vattr vattr local
764 struct vattr vattr; local
    [all...]
  /netvirt/usr/src/uts/common/sys/fs/
sdev_node.h 50 int (*devnops_getattr)(devname_handle_t *, struct vattr *,
tmp.h 95 struct vattr *, struct cred *);
112 enum de_op, struct tmpnode *, struct tmpnode *, struct vattr *,
namenode.h 59 struct vattr nm_vattr; /* attributes of mounted file desc. */
sdev_impl.h 180 struct vattr *sdev_attr; /* memory copy of the vattr */
306 extern struct vattr sdev_vattr_dir;
307 extern struct vattr sdev_vattr_lnk;
308 extern struct vattr sdev_vattr_blk;
309 extern struct vattr sdev_vattr_chr;
323 #define SDEV_VATTR 0x4 /* callback returning node vattr */
338 extern int devname_setattr_func(struct vnode *, struct vattr *, int,
339 struct cred *, int (*)(struct sdev_node *, struct vattr *, int), int);
580 struct vattr *, struct vnode *, void *, struct cred *, sdev_node_state_t)
    [all...]
dv_node.h 77 struct vattr *dv_attr; /* attributes not yet persistent */
126 * Compare a vattr's and mperm_t's minor permissions (uid, gid & mode)
134 * Merge an mperm_t's minor permissions into a vattr
172 extern void dv_vattr_merge(struct dv_node *, struct vattr *);
180 extern void devfs_get_defattr(vnode_t *, struct vattr *, int *);
  /netvirt/usr/src/uts/common/vm/
vm_rm.c 109 vattr_t vattr; local
116 vattr.va_mask = AT_SIZE;
120 VOP_GETATTR(vp, &vattr, ATTR_HINT,
122 u_offset_t filesize = vattr.va_size;
  /netvirt/usr/src/uts/common/fs/nfs/
nfs3_srv.c 81 static int sattr3_to_vattr(sattr3 *, struct vattr *);
82 static int vattr_to_fattr3(struct vattr *, fattr3 *);
83 static int vattr_to_wcc_attr(struct vattr *, wcc_attr *);
84 static void vattr_to_pre_op_attr(struct vattr *, pre_op_attr *);
85 static void vattr_to_wcc_data(struct vattr *, struct vattr *, wcc_data *);
96 struct vattr va;
139 struct vattr *bvap;
140 struct vattr bva;
141 struct vattr *avap
    [all...]
  /netvirt/usr/src/uts/common/fs/cachefs/
cachefs_dlog.c 106 * check attr error - if we get an overflow error copying vattr, make sure
187 struct vattr vattr; local
213 vattr.va_mode = S_IFREG | 0666;
214 vattr.va_uid = 0;
215 vattr.va_gid = 0;
216 vattr.va_type = VREG;
217 vattr.va_mask = AT_TYPE|AT_MODE|AT_UID|AT_GID;
219 &vattr, 0, 0666, &fscp->fs_dlogfile, kcred, 0, NULL, NULL);
242 vattr.va_mode = S_IFREG | 0666
    [all...]
  /netvirt/usr/src/uts/common/fs/
fs_subr.c 592 struct vattr vattr; local
602 vattr.va_mask = AT_MODE | AT_UID | AT_GID;
603 if (error = VOP_GETATTR(vp, &vattr, 0, cr, ct))
613 aclentp->a_perm = ((ushort_t)(vattr.va_mode & 0700)) >> 6;
614 aclentp->a_id = vattr.va_uid; /* Really undefined */
618 aclentp->a_perm = ((ushort_t)(vattr.va_mode & 0070)) >> 3;
619 aclentp->a_id = vattr.va_gid; /* Really undefined */
623 aclentp->a_perm = vattr.va_mode & 0007;
637 adjust_ace_pair(acep, (vattr.va_mode & 0700) >> 6)
    [all...]
  /netvirt/usr/src/uts/common/fs/devfs/
devfs_vnops.c 66 extern struct vattr dv_vattr_dir, dv_vattr_file;
163 devfs_getattr(struct vnode *vp, struct vattr *vap, int flags, struct cred *cr,
221 struct vattr *vap,
225 struct vattr *map;
228 struct vattr vattr; local
300 vattr = dv_vattr_dir;
302 &vattr, flags, cr, NULL) == 0) {
304 sizeof (struct vattr), KM_SLEEP);
305 *dv->dv_attr = vattr;
    [all...]
  /netvirt/usr/src/uts/common/fs/zfs/
vdev_file.c 90 vattr_t vattr; local
101 vattr.va_mask = AT_SIZE;
102 error = VOP_GETATTR(vf->vf_vnode, &vattr, 0, kcred, NULL);
108 *psize = vattr.va_size;
  /netvirt/usr/src/uts/common/os/
urw.c 67 vattr_t vattr; local
73 vattr.va_mask = AT_SIZE;
77 VOP_GETATTR(vp, &vattr, 0, CRED(), NULL) == 0) {
78 u_offset_t size = roundup(vattr.va_size, (u_offset_t)PAGESIZE);
dumpsubr.c 192 vattr_t vattr; local
212 vattr.va_mask = AT_SIZE | AT_TYPE | AT_RDEV;
213 if ((error = VOP_GETATTR(cvp, &vattr, 0, kcred, NULL)) == 0) {
214 if (vattr.va_type == VBLK || vattr.va_type == VCHR) {
215 if (devopsp[getmajor(vattr.va_rdev)]->
218 else if (vfs_devismounted(vattr.va_rdev))
227 if (error == 0 && vattr.va_size < 2 * DUMP_LOGSIZE + DUMP_ERPTSIZE)
242 dumpvp_size = vattr.va_size & -DUMP_OFFSET;
  /netvirt/usr/src/uts/common/fs/dev/
sdev_ptsops.c 175 struct vattr *vap = (struct vattr *)arg;
336 devpts_create(struct vnode *dvp, char *nm, struct vattr *vap, vcexcl_t excl,
386 devpts_set_id(struct sdev_node *dv, struct vattr *vap, int protocol)
397 devpts_setattr(struct vnode *vp, struct vattr *vap, int flags,

Completed in 2639 milliseconds

1 2 3 4 5 6